Developer and Database Analyst (DBA)

Gravita

Not Interested
Bookmark
Report This Job

profile Job Location:

London - UK

profile Monthly Salary: Not Disclosed
Posted on: Yesterday
Vacancies: 1 Vacancy

Job Summary

Were Gravita: the accountants fuelling ambitious businesses. Were a full service tech-enabled firm working with entrepreneurs and businesses to help them achieve their goals and make an impact in the world.

Were growing fast and are bringing like-minded advisors together to form a full-service tech-enabled accounting partner for thousands of SMEs. Our team use their incredible expertise alongside intuitive technology to help businesses and entrepreneurs plan better and grow faster.

Our mission is to become the UKs leading tech-enabled accounting firm for SMEs. We have ambitious goals and our high-calibre team work hard to achieve them. We are one team with one agenda working collaboratively in a respectful environment to deliver a great service to our clients. So if you join us youll not only be working on exciting client challenges youll also be helping us shape the future of accounting.

The Role

We are looking for a developer / DBA who is eager to develop and learn in a fast moving environment.

You will be responsible for development and managing our Azure datalake environment our Microsoft SQL Database API interefaces. You will also be a key member of the team who drives the use of data and AI in our business as the accountancy profession transforms itself.

The Gravita Technology team is a small team with large ambitions. If you join us you will be exposed to fast moving environment and have you will have the opportunity to learn and develop quickly.

The key skills required include

  • Python

  • SQL - Possible DBT experience.

  • Git

  • Databricks Governance (Nice to have) But can be learnt.

  • Pyspark (Nice to have) But can be learnt

You will report to our IT Delivery Manager who has a wealth of software development experience and work alongside our other Software Engineer.

Key Responsibilities:

  • Develop archictect and operate our Deltalake.

  • Develop and operate key API interfaces between our Operational systems

  • Manage and optimise our core CCH Practice Management System database. Work includes working with the Gravita Data lead to drive improvements in the quality of our operational data.

  • Develop procedures that can be operated by the support team

API/Interfaces

  • Develop and manage interfaces between Core operational systems.

  • Create new SQL Tables for Ingested Data.

  • Diagnose and fix issues with any Data Pipeline runs.

Gravita Datalake

  • On-going development and management of Deltalake.

  • Convert old T-SQL for New Environment.

  • Create new DBT Models to create Silver and Gold Level Tables / Views.

  • Manage Governance of Databricks Unity Catalog.

  • Work with PowerBI developer to ensure we have the necessary MIS reports.

  • Assist the PowerBI team to move over to Deltalake.

CCH Database

  • Work with Data team on the data cleansing.

  • Optimize SQL Queries.

  • Deploy dashboards for Data Quality Monitoring.

Data and AI Strategy

  • Be a key member of the team developing Gravitas data and AI strategy. Develop data skills in new areas and help Gravita get benefit.

General

  • Use Git to version control projects.

  • Consult on Database and SQL issues.

  • Manage & Maintain Databases Ensure our databases are secure high-performing and scalable implementing best practices in administration backup and recovery

  • Database Development Design build and optimize database components to support our website and feature requirements ensuring seamless functionality.

  • Security & Compliance Enforce security measures access controls and compliance protocols to protect sensitive data.

  • SQL Query Development Write efficient queries stored procedures and database scripts to support business operations and new system developments.

  • Collaboration & Problem-Solving Work closely with cross-functional teams proactively solving data-related challenges and contributing to key projects.

Qualifications Knowledge & Experience:

Experience

  • Python (3 years) with ideally API Intetgration experience

  • 3 years experience in SQL Development with ideally hands-on Azure SQL Database administration

  • Azure SQL Azure Analytics Dataverse or similar solutions or a willingness to learn and develop

  • Some DBT experience

  • Good T-SQL (queries stored procedures indexing performance tuning)

  • Experience maintaining optimising and scaling production databases

  • Knowledge of Data Pipelines Managing and evolving our Azure-hosted SQL infrastructure

  • Supporting the dev team with schema updates and data integrity

  • Handling SQL support tickets from data updates to complex merges

In General

  • A problem-solving mindset with the ability to understand business collegues requirements and then work independently and collaboratively in a fast-moving team.

  • Good organisation with the ability to juggle multiple priorities work independently and maintain control in dynamic situations

  • Creative and analytical thinker with a solutions-focused mindset always looking for better ways of doing things

Your Career with Gravita

When you join Gravita well support you on your own growth journey. We want to be the place you learn grow and unlock your true potential.

Well work with you to build a progression plan to outline how youll grow at our company and everything well do to help you get there. Were also passionate about learning and development to help you focus on your future.

The Nitty Gritty

  • Our standard working week is a 37.5-hour week on a hybrid basis

  • Core working hours are 10am - 4pm Monday to Friday

  • Flexible working and happy employees are at the top of our list here at Gravita and we have been working hard to support our teams through the fast-paced changes.

  • Your development wont be forgotten our development support is extraordinary for a firm of our size.

  • Its a busy fast-paced environment here at Gravita. Feel free to check out our social media channels (Instagram X LinkedIn and Glassdoor).

Were Gravita: the accountants fuelling ambitious businesses. Were a full service tech-enabled firm working with entrepreneurs and businesses to help them achieve their goals and make an impact in the world.Were growing fast and are bringing like-minded advisors together to form a full-service tech-e...
View more view more

Key Skills

  • Databases
  • SQL
  • Database Development
  • PL/SQL
  • Microsoft SQL Server
  • ssrs
  • Database Design
  • SSIS
  • T Sql
  • Sybase
  • Data Warehouse
  • Oracle

About Company

Company Logo

Were Gravita: the accountants fuelling ambitious businesses. Were a full service tech-enabled firm working with entrepreneurs and businesses to help them achieve their goals and make an impact in the world.Were growing fast and are bringing like-minded advisors together to form a full ... View more

View Profile View Profile